Output 5b1492918a4e84dc6db64dee07682f54c5acfc0d35a958de277ff8fd0308d5ef:1

value
42346400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141f568213c5a320b96ec157a3cf080b243a2856 OP_EQUAL
address
33XQyn3MKPJopfmeehW32hbTSvDZDewypr
transaction
5b1492918a4e84dc6db64dee07682f54c5acfc0d35a958de277ff8fd0308d5ef
confirmations
155120
spent
true